在工业自动化领域,可编程逻辑控制器(PLC)和触摸屏(HMI)是两个不可或缺的组成部分。它们协同工作,使得工业生产过程更加高效、安全。本文将带你轻松入门PLC与触摸屏编程,并通过实操案例让你玩转工业自动化控制。
一、PLC与触摸屏概述
1. PLC
PLC,即可编程逻辑控制器,是一种用于工业控制的数字运算操作电子系统。它采用可编程存储器,用于存储用户自定义的指令集,用于实现特定的控制功能。PLC具有可靠性高、抗干扰能力强、编程灵活等优点,广泛应用于各种工业控制场合。
2. 触摸屏
触摸屏,即人机界面(HMI),是一种用于人与机器交互的设备。它通过触摸屏幕实现操作,将操作者与机器连接起来。触摸屏具有直观、易用、易于维护等特点,广泛应用于工业自动化领域。
二、PLC与触摸屏编程入门
1. PLC编程
PLC编程主要使用梯形图、功能块图、指令列表等编程语言。以下是一个简单的PLC编程案例:
// 梯形图
[启动按钮] -> [启动继电器] -> [停止按钮] -> [停止继电器]
在这个案例中,当启动按钮被按下时,启动继电器得电,控制设备开始工作;当停止按钮被按下时,停止继电器得电,控制设备停止工作。
2. 触摸屏编程
触摸屏编程主要使用图形化编程语言,如WinCC、GX Works2等。以下是一个简单的触摸屏编程案例:
// WinCC
[启动按钮] -> [启动PLC] -> [停止按钮] -> [停止PLC]
在这个案例中,当启动按钮被点击时,PLC开始运行;当停止按钮被点击时,PLC停止运行。
三、实操案例:PLC与触摸屏控制流水线
以下是一个实操案例,展示如何使用PLC和触摸屏控制流水线:
1. 硬件连接
将PLC、触摸屏、传感器、执行器等设备连接到流水线上,确保各个设备之间通信正常。
2. PLC编程
编写PLC程序,实现以下功能:
- 读取传感器信号,判断物料是否到达;
- 控制执行器,控制物料输送;
- 显示触摸屏上的实时状态。
3. 触摸屏编程
编写触摸屏程序,实现以下功能:
- 显示流水线实时状态;
- 设置参数,如输送速度、延时等;
- 控制PLC程序运行。
4. 联调测试
将PLC程序和触摸屏程序上传到设备,进行联调测试。确保流水线运行正常,满足生产需求。
四、总结
通过本文的学习,相信你已经对PLC与触摸屏编程有了初步的了解。在实际应用中,不断积累经验,提高编程技能,才能更好地玩转工业自动化控制。希望本文能对你有所帮助!
